powerpc/powernv: Cleanup on EEH comments
authorGavin Shan <gwshan@linux.vnet.ibm.com>
Thu, 8 Oct 2015 03:58:57 +0000 (14:58 +1100)
committerMichael Ellerman <mpe@ellerman.id.au>
Wed, 21 Oct 2015 09:42:15 +0000 (20:42 +1100)
This applies cleanup on eeh-powernv.c, no functional changes:

   * Remove unnecessary comments and empty line.
   * Correct inaccurate comments.

Signed-off-by: Gavin Shan <gwshan@linux.vnet.ibm.com>
Signed-off-by: Michael Ellerman <mpe@ellerman.id.au>
